FTSE indices are available for a range of asset classes and world markets. In total, over 120,000 indices are calculated every day, ranging from the well-known FTSE 100, to indices covering corporate bonds, hedge funds, real estate, emerging & frontier markets and even niche indices covering Shariah law and stock exchanges.
FTSE also calculates indices that measure non-financial as well as financial risk. The FTSE4Good index, launched in July 2001, is recognized as the global measure for responsible investment.
